Departments - LOBELIA Starship Blue #2
Back
LOBELIA Starship Blue #2
no reviews for this product. Login to place a review.
$18.74/ EA
Latin: Lobelia speciosa STARSHIP(TM) Blue / EA $18.74 558061108 |